How do I sort a list that contains blanks that I want to keep?
I have copied a list from a pivot table, so there are blanks. Is there a way
for me to sort, and maintain those blanks. For example I have a list that looks kind of like this: John Smith Red Orange Yellow John Doe Green Mary Peters Red Purple It is important to know that John Smith goes along with Red, Orange and Yellow. But I want to be able to sort the page so all of the people that only like one color are grouped together and all of the people with multiple colors are grouped together. |
